- Synonyms: energy, enthusiasm, excitement, delight, pleasure
- Antonyms: nonchalance, reluctance, hesitation
- Etymology: 1629 Latin, from gustus meaning "to taste," which actually comes from the ancient European root geus- meaning "enjoy or be pleased"
- Example: I talk to others about my class with great gusto!
